Transaction 8739b71707492bc0e684de2986ce80c978a56bc75e3eeb903a4d17e50a3aa72e
1 Input
1 Output
-
8739b71707492bc0e684de2986ce80c978a56bc75e3eeb903a4d17e50a3aa72e:0
- value
- 899987577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ec44e3fa57da1dc1c351500c87484e5fb9a04c3f OP_EQUAL
- address
- 3PEHvQysjnnPLct9M3hUcwauWzTBhioyzN